MADRAS H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2012
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 60(1)(c) -- Property liable to attachment and sale in execution of decree - Scope - Held, property cannot be brought for sale if house is under occupation and ownership of agriculturalist or agricultural labourer - However, there is no embargo for an agriculturalist who is in occupation of his property including his house to mortgage and..........

ANDHRA PRADESH H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2012
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 60, Order 38, Rule 5 -- Attachment before judgment - Retiral benefits such as pension and gratuity - Exempt u/s 60(1) CPC - Cannot be attached...........

PUNJAB AND HARAYANA H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2012
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 60, Order 21 -- Execution of decree - Attachment of property - Contention that disputed property being residential property is exempted from attachment in execution proceedings - Held, contention cannot be raised by objector being third party - Since objector has failed to establish any right, title or interest in disputed property,..........

ANDHRA PRADESH H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2011
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 60 -- Attachment of salary - Held, salary is debt and, therefore, Court has power to direct its attachment...........

ANDHRA PRADESH H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2011
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 60(1)(i) -- Proviso - Salary of employee - Attachment of - Prohibition against - Held, proviso makes it clear that once salary of an employee was subjected to attachment for a period of 24 months, no further attachment can be made, in respect of that very decree, though attachment in respect of other decrees can be made after expiry of..........
